Ketu North Breaks Ground for New KG Classroom Block

The Ketu North Municipal Assembly has taken a significant step towards enhancing early childhood education with the sod-cutting ceremony for a two-unit KG classroom block at Dzodze Fiagbedu R.C. School. The project, which includes ancillary facilities, aims to provide a safer and more conducive learning environment for children in the area.
According to the Volta Regional Minister, Hon. James Gunu, investing in early childhood education is crucial for shaping the future of Ketu North and the Volta Region. The construction of the classroom block reflects the shared commitment of stakeholders to deliver quality social infrastructure that supports learning and nurtures young minds.
The project is part of the Municipal Assembly’s broader development agenda to address critical infrastructure gaps in the education sector, particularly in underserved communities. The new classroom block is expected to ease congestion, enhance teaching and learning, and provide a more comfortable environment for pupils and teachers.
The sod-cutting ceremony was attended by the Member of Parliament for Ketu North, Hon. Edem Agbana, the Municipal Chief Executive, Hon. Rev. Martin Amenaki, and other stakeholders. The event underscores the collaborative effort to improve education in the area.
The Ketu North Municipal Assembly has been working to address infrastructure gaps in the health and education sectors. The construction of the KG classroom block is one of four major infrastructure projects aimed at improving access to quality education and healthcare in the municipality.
The timely completion of the project is expected to significantly improve service delivery and enhance the quality of life of residents in the Ketu North Municipality.
